HMC's Communicable Disease Center Awarded Gold Certification

Doha, June 02 (QNA) - Hamad Medical Corporation's Communicable Disease Center (CDC) has been awarded Certification with Distinction for Leadership and Innovation in Person-Centered Care by Planetree.

This Distinction recognizes the organization's work to continually advance the practice of person-centered care through outreach, research, scholarship, and innovation.

CDC is the second organization in the MENA region, and one of only six organizations worldwide, to be honored by Planetree with its "Distinction in Leadership and Innovation in Person-Centered Care Award". This achievement builds on the CDC being awarded Gold Certification for Excellence in Person-Centered Care in 2021.

Achievement of Distinction status which the highest level of recognition conferred by Planetree, requires organizations to earn re-Certification for Excellence in Person-Centered Care at the Gold-level, while also building on their success to advance the model of person-centered care beyond the standards outlined in the person-centered care program.

Before a healthcare organization can achieve Planetree Distinction, it must meet a rigorous set of criteria that patients, family members, and healthcare professionals have indicated are elements that matter the most when it comes to their healthcare experience. Organizations must also showcase performance that advances the model of person-centered care, going above and beyond the criteria required to achieve Gold Certification.

The CDC is a 65-bed, single inpatient room specialist tertiary center with outpatient and community services, that supports and treats patients with a spectrum of communicable diseases. The center promotes awareness and education with the goal of preventing and combatting various infectious diseases at a national level.

Chief Medical Officer of HMC Dr. Khalid Mohammed Al Jalham, said that the Gold re-certification with Distinction status is testament to the tireless efforts that we are making to provide compassionate, personalized, and holistic care, where patients and families are empowered and actively engaged in their care journey, and where staff feel valued and supported by their leadership.

HMC's Chief of Patient Experience and Director of Hamad Healthcare Quality Institute Nasser Al Naimi, said: "CDC receiving Planetree Gold certification with Distinction for Leadership and Innovation in PCC for the first time demonstrates their commitment to providing an environment that empowers, respects, and cares for patients and their families, by putting them at the center of their healthcare journey".

Chief Executive Officer, Medical Director, and the PCC Executive Champion of CDC Dr. Muna Al Maslamani, said: "We are proud of this achievement and remain committed to delivering person-centered care with excellence. This award recognizes CDC's high level of commitment to improving the entire healthcare experience by engaging patients, families, and the communities that we serve."

President Michael Giuliano of Planetree International, a not-for-profit organization that has been at the forefront of the movement to transform healthcare from the perspective of patients for more than 45 years, said: "The Planetree Certification is the only award that recognizes excellence in person-centeredness across the continuum of care."

"By sharing their successes and challenges, CDC has exponentially increased the impact of its person-centered culture to benefit not only patients, families, and professional caregivers in its local community, but also those all over the country and even globally," Giuliano explained. (QNA)
